社区
C语言
帖子详情
如何知道平均一条c代码对应几条机器指令,从而知道需要花多少时间
cg
2001-11-15 07:27:22
...全文
119
3
打赏
收藏
如何知道平均一条c代码对应几条机器指令,从而知道需要花多少时间
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
cnss
2001-11-15
打赏
举报
回复
用VC生成汇编语言表,可以看到每条C语言对应的一条或若干条汇编语句
然后每条汇编语句都有cycle time,就是执行一条语句用几个时钟周期
不过,通过这些,只能大概估计一下运行的时间,毕竟在多任务的环境下,影响时间的因素太多了
november5
2001-11-15
打赏
举报
回复
这。。。这。。。太难了吧
gffly
2001-11-15
打赏
举报
回复
这要看你的C语句,每个句子的差异很大,有的快,有的慢,
最好是从一段程序来估算所用的时间,看他的时间复杂度
c语言执行
一条
指令几个机器周期,时钟周期、机器周期与指令周期
时钟周期、机器周期与指令周期1、51系列单片机中,外部输入震荡输入经2分频后作为时钟;另外,一个机器周期由6个时钟周期组成;因为没有流水线(pipeline)结构,执行
一条
指令
需要
经过取指令、译码、存取操作数、执行、保存等基本步骤,因此,把完成一步
需要
的
时间
称为机器周期。执行
一条
指令
需要
的
时间
就是质量周期;由于指令功能的不同,使得执行
一条
指令
需要
的机器周期数也不同,一般是一个或多个机器周期。综合有...
简述
机器指令
与微指令之间的关系_计算机组成原理习题 -
计算机组成原理习题8微程序控制器中,
机器指令
与微指令的关系是______。 A. 每
一条
机器指令
由
一条
微指令来执行B. 每
一条
机器指令
组成的程序可由
一条
微指令来执行 C.每
一条
机器指令
由一段微指令编写的微程序来解释执行 D.
一条
微指令由若干条
机器指令
组成9微程序控制器中,
机器指令
与微指令的关系是______。 A. 每
一条
机器指令
由
一条
微指令来执行B. 每
一条
机器指令
由一段微指令编写的微程序来...
STM32的指令周期
在keil中编程时,写了一行
代码
,然后就想
知道
,执行这句C
代码
需要
多长
时间
。 时钟周期在这就不解释了,频率的倒数。 指令周期,个人理解就是cpu执行
一条
汇编指令所
需要
的
时间
。 我们
知道
cm3使用的三级流水线,那么到底
一条
指令的执行
需要
多少个时钟周期。下面通过keil软件仿真,来计算一个指令所需的时钟周期。 使用STM32F103RC,。配置其主时钟HCLK为72mhz测试
代码
如下: ...
命令计算机执行指定的操作,计算机如何执行
一条
机器指令
计算机如何执行
一条
机器指令
计算机如何执行
一条
机器指令
文章目录指令运行过程:微程序控制基本概念:几个周期区别寻址方式:指令运行过程:?在上篇我们谈到,计算机处理一段程序,就会将程序翻译成
机器指令
,然后执行完成相应的任务。执行指令的过程分为取指令阶段、分析取数阶段和执行阶段。1.取指阶段:图中概念解释:PC(程序计数器),MAR(存储地址寄存器),CU(控制单元),IR(指令寄存器)AB(地址总线) ...
汇编指令和
机器指令
汇编指令是
机器指令
便于记忆的书写格式。 《汇编语言》王爽
C语言
70,012
社区成员
243,258
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章